Birmingham

Birmingham is a major player on the world stage. Vibrant, dynamic, and cosmopolitan, you'll find plenty to entertain you. Stimulate your mind at a museum, relax in one of the beautiful parks or enjoy one of the many sporting or cultural events that Birmingham has to offer.

Shopping

Birmingham has some of the best shopping in the world. The Bullring is the glamorous shopping centre situated in the heart of Birmingham with over 160 shops and more than 25 restaurants.

Food and drink

You'll be spoilt for choice as Birmingham has a large number of restaurants, cafes and bars. Birmingham is also home to a wide variety of Asian eateries which have served the people of Birmingham since the 1940s.

Guildford

Only a short journey from London, Guildford offers a quick escape into peaceful countryside. 80% of the county is farmland, woods, heath and open land.


Surrey provides a wealth of contrasting leisure activities. Among the historic sites are Hampton Court Palace and Runnymede, as well as National Trust properties such as Clandon and Polesden Lacey. Other attractions include picturesque villages, gardens, such as Wisley, racecourses and river trips. Surrey also has seven major arts venues.

London

London is one of the best places in the world to have fun and enjoy yourself. The wide variety of leisure opportunities and attractions in London is enormous including art galleries, museums, cinemas, theatres, dance, music, restaurants, pubs, stately homes, zoos, theme parks, major sporting stadiums, exhibitions and much more.


London also has many famous attractions such as the London Eye, Big Ben, the Tower of London, Madame Tussauds, The London Dungeon, and many more.


London also has many parks and it's surprising how peaceful they can be. Hyde Park, Richmond Park, Battersea Park, Kensington Gardens, Green Park and St James's Park are just a few.

Manchester

Manchester is a city with a population of around three million and has what locals would call "Northern charm" - a real sense of community. This is England with a difference. With some of the most eye catching architecture in the UK you can enjoy the superb shopping, eating, drinking and nightlife in the city or head out to stunning countryside in the surrounding towns and villages.

Food and drink

Manchester has an endless choice of bars and restaurants, and its world famous nightlife attracts visitors from all over the UK and overseas. Fish and chips are a local institution in Manchester, but the city offers an unprecedented choice of international foods, especially Indian -witness the 'curry mile.'
